What Makes Things Stick?

When you think about baking, your mind may immediately jump to the sugar that sweetens your treats or the butter that makes them rich and delicious. But have you ever stopped to consider the critical role of proteins and starches? Let’s break it down.

  • Proteins (Like Eggs): These little powerhouses not only provide structure but also help stabilize your mixtures when heated. When you whisk eggs into your batter, those proteins start to unfold and coagulate (which is just a fancy term for solidifying). This gives your baked goods that much-needed support.

  • Starches (Hello, Flour!): Flour does more than just add bulk to your recipe; its starches absorb liquid and expand during baking. Imagine flour as a sponge soaking up water—this process is essential for binding. As the starches swell, they help create a network that traps air and moisture, leading to that fluffy texture we all love.

Why Not Just Liquids?

You may be thinking, “Why can’t I just use liquids to bind my mixtures?” Here's the deal: while liquids are crucial for hydration—think about how dry ingredients need some moisture to come together—they lack the stabilizing power that proteins and starches deliver. Just mixing in some milk or water isn’t enough to hold a cake together!

But wait! Don’t forget about our other baking buddies: sugars and fats. Sure, they have their own essential roles—contributing sweetness, flavor, and moisture—but they don’t quite have the binding prowess that proteins and starches do. Fats, while delightful for making things rich and tender, lean more towards enhancing flavor or mouthfeel rather than binding.
